Slots are games where players spin the reels to try to line up matching symbols on a payline. The symbols usually appear on vertical reels that can have three, five, or more rows. The reels spin and then stop randomly, thanks to a random number generator (RNG) that’s audited by independent agencies. Players can win money by lining up the matching symbols on a payline, which run horizontally across the screen (though some have diagonal and vertical lines as well).

The most common type of online slot is a video slot. These offer many more features than the classic arcade machines you’ve probably seen before. For example, video slots often feature multiple paylines, scatter symbols, wild symbols, and bonus rounds. They can also have animations and sounds to add to the overall experience. These features can make a slot game much more exciting and immersive than the simple mechanical reels found in traditional brick-and-mortar casinos.

Another thing to consider when choosing an online slot is the return to player (RTP) rate. This is an indicator of how much you’re likely to win on a particular slot. The higher the RTP, the better your chances of winning are. However, it’s important to remember that no online slot game is 100% accurate.
